11.2.3. Configuring the Compute node for vGPU and deploying the overcloud
You need to retrieve and assign the vGPU type that corresponds to the physical GPU device in your environment, and prepare the environment files to configure the Compute node for vGPU.
Procedure
- Install Red Hat Enterprise Linux and the NVIDIA GRID driver on a temporary Compute node and launch the node. For more information about installing the NVIDIA GRID driver, see 「Building a custom GPU overcloud image」.
On the Compute node, locate the vGPU type of the physical GPU device that you want to enable. For libvirt, virtual GPUs are mediated devices, or
mdevtype devices. To discover the supportedmdevdevices, enter the following command:[root@overcloud-computegpu-0 ~]# ls /sys/class/mdev_bus/0000\:06\:00.0/mdev_supported_types/ nvidia-11 nvidia-12 nvidia-13 nvidia-14 nvidia-15 nvidia-16 nvidia-17 nvidia-18 nvidia-19 nvidia-20 nvidia-21 nvidia-210 nvidia-22 [root@overcloud-computegpu-0 ~]# cat /sys/class/mdev_bus/0000\:06\:00.0/mdev_supported_types/nvidia-18/description num_heads=4, frl_config=60, framebuffer=2048M, max_resolution=4096x2160, max_instance=4Add the
compute-gpu.yamlfile to thenetwork-environment.yamlfile:resource_registry: OS::TripleO::Compute::Net::SoftwareConfig: /home/stack/templates/nic-configs/compute.yaml OS::TripleO::ComputeGpu::Net::SoftwareConfig: /home/stack/templates/nic-configs/compute-gpu.yaml OS::TripleO::Controller::Net::SoftwareConfig: /home/stack/templates/nic-configs/controller.yaml #OS::TripleO::AllNodes::Validation: OS::Heat::NoneAdd the following parameters to the
node-info.yamlfile to specify the number of GPU-enabled Compute nodes, and the flavor to use for the vGPU-designated Compute nodes:parameter_defaults: OvercloudControllerFlavor: control OvercloudComputeFlavor: compute OvercloudComputeGpuFlavor: compute-vgpu-nvidia ControllerCount: 1 ComputeCount: 0 ComputeGpuCount: 3 #set to the no of GPU nodes you haveCreate a
gpu.yamlfile to specify the vGPU type of your GPU device:parameter_defaults: ComputeGpuExtraConfig: nova::compute::vgpu::enabled_vgpu_types: - nvidia-18注記Each physical GPU supports only one virtual GPU type. If you specify multiple vGPU types in this property, only the first type is used.
Deploy the overcloud, adding your new role and environment files to the stack along with your other environment files:
(undercloud) $ openstack overcloud deploy --templates \ -r /home/stack/templates/roles_data_gpu.yaml -e /home/stack/templates/node-info.yaml -e /home/stack/templates/network-environment.yaml -e [your environment files] -e /home/stack/templates/gpu.yaml
